  A typical case:
  
  1- Alt+F2 to run a command
- 2- Type only the first letters of ubuntu-bug
+ 2- Type only the first letters of 'ubuntu-bug'
  3- See suggestions from Results and History
  4- Try to select ubuntu-bug from Results to be part of your command
  
  You can't use the suggestions from 'Results' and 'History' to be part of
  your command. If you clicked on 'ubuntu-bug' from 'Results', Dash closes
  without completing the command. Or if you want to use only parts of a
  previous command from 'History', you can't; you have to select &
  implement the whole command.
